Web18 sep. 2024 · Therefore, hemiplegia means paralysis on one half of the body, usually as a result of stroke. However, traumatic brain injury, spinal cord injury, and other neurological conditions can also cause hemiplegia. In contrast, the term ”paresis” sounds a lot like paralysis, but it actually denotes weakness. Web7 apr. 2024 · Ans: Hemiparesis is a condition that results in slight weakness such as mild loss of strength, either in any part of the body or half part of the body. Hemiplegia, on the other hand, is the condition when a part of the body or half portion of the body is paralysed. Thus, hemiplegia is a severe condition of hemiparesis. palate\u0027s we
